Includes bibliographical references and index.
Acknowledgements -- Introduction global crisis : insecurity, terrorism, and human rights -- Islamism, al Qaeda, and takfir -- Iraq, 2003 : the Shia resurgence, Zarqawi's legacy, and the Islamic state -- Syria, 2011 : convoluted loyalties, a chaotic insurgency, and the revival of the caliphate -- Afghanistan 2001 : centuries of imperialism, the rise of the mujahidin, and the taliban -- Pakistan, 2004 : blasphemy, tribalism, and a state of insecurity -- Al Qaeda's global crisis : defending takfir, losing relevance and the rise of the Islamic state -- Bibliography -- Index.
